Heads up, team — the new fifth floor at Quillbrook House opens Monday, and visitor rules are a bit different up there. Assistants can book guests through the usual Fernway portal, but fifth-floor visitors must be collected from the third-floor lounge, not the lobby, since the lifts won't stop at five without a pass. Badges are being reissued over the next fortnight, so for now the stairwell door is on a keypad. The interim code for the fifth-floor stairwell is below.

door code, yagap-bahof: bdg-O-05

Contractors visiting Aldmere Yard may use the covered bike cage beside the south parking gates, subject to space. The cage is intended primarily for staff, so please do not leave bikes overnight or chain them to the gate railings. The parking gates open automatically for booked vehicles between 07:00 and 19:00; outside those hours, contact the duty officer before arriving. The bike cage itself is locked at all times, and the keypad on its side gate accepts the code below.

turnstile pass: bdg-FVNQRS-72965873

**Wiki: Artifact Signing — StageGrid Seat-Map Renderer**

All release artifacts for StageGrid, the seat-map renderer used by the Orpheline Theatre deployment, must be signed before promotion. The pipeline verifies the signature at the staging gate and again at production cutover; unsigned or mismatched artifacts are rejected automatically. Release managers should confirm the fingerprint against this page before approving. The current release signing key is recorded below.

deploy key for kajof-fajop: bky6_gDHw9Q

FAQ: Should I enable websocket compression on Relayline? Short answer: it depends on your payloads. permessage-deflate cuts bandwidth roughly 60% on our JSON telemetry frames, but it adds CPU cost and per-connection memory for the compression context, which hurts on the smaller Bramford edge nodes. For binary or already-compressed payloads, leave it off. New contractors: test both modes in the staging mesh before changing defaults. To access the staging config vault and flip the setting, you'll need the recovery passphrase shown below.

strongbox words: sorir-belvan-rusix-ulays-ralmir-praix-eliir-tamax-praael-druael-julir-tamius-jorir